TERESA DOLORES ROMERO, Plaintiff, v. MARTIN O'MALLEY,[1] Acting Commissioner of Social Security, Defendant.

E. MARTIN ESTRADA, DAVID M. HARRIS, CEDINA M. KIM, ELIZABETH LANDGRAF, Attorneys for Defendant


E. MARTIN ESTRADA, DAVID M. HARRIS, CEDINA M. KIM, ELIZABETH LANDGRAF, Attorneys for Defendant

JUDGMENT OF REMAND

HONORABLE STEVE KIM, UNITED STATES MAGISTRATE JUDGE

The Court having approved the parties' Stipulation to Voluntary Remand Pursuant to Sentence Four of 42 U.S.C. § 405(g) (“Stipulation to Remand”) lodged concurrently with the lodging of the within Judgment of Remand, IT IS HEREBY ORDERED, ADJUDGED, AND DECREED that the above-captioned action is remanded to the Commissioner of Social Security for further proceedings consistent with the Stipulation to Remand.
